South Park experiences a series of accidents caused by senior citizens and their poor driving skills. When the seniors are treated like children, and are forced to give up their driver's licenses, they fight back with the assistance of the AARP.

| Title: Grey Dawn
The episode's title, and several plot points are taken from the film, Red Dawn (1984). | Mr. Garrison: And so you see, children, Genghis Khan was a 'Mongol,' not to be confused with a 'mongoloid' like the actor, Nicolas Cage.
Nicolas Cage is an American actor known for his roles in films such as Raising Arizona, Con Air, and Leaving Las Vegas. He is NOT a mongoloid (slur for a person with Down's Syndrome). |
| |
| Cartman: Looks like Stan's dad's been hittin' the bottle again.
We have seen Randy drunk in previous episodes such as 2x02 "Clubhouses" and 3x14 "The Red Badge of Gayness." His drinking problem isn't seriously addressed until the later episode, 9x14 "Bloody Mary." |
